手机app直播制作中数据传输问题
随着移动互联网的快速发展,手机app直播已成为当下最受欢迎的娱乐方式之一。然而,在直播制作过程中,数据传输问题一直是困扰许多用户和开发者的难题。本文将深入探讨手机app直播制作中的数据传输问题,并分析其产生的原因及解决方法。
一、数据传输问题概述
手机app直播制作中的数据传输问题主要包括以下三个方面:
- 数据延迟:直播过程中,由于网络不稳定或服务器处理能力不足,导致观众观看直播时出现画面和声音延迟的情况。
- 数据丢失:在直播过程中,由于网络波动或服务器压力过大,导致部分数据无法成功传输,观众无法完整观看直播内容。
- 数据拥堵:当多个用户同时观看同一直播时,服务器处理能力不足,导致数据传输拥堵,影响观看体验。
二、数据传输问题产生的原因
- 网络环境:网络不稳定是导致数据传输问题的主要原因之一。在偏远地区或网络覆盖较差的区域,用户无法享受到稳定的网络环境,从而影响直播效果。
- 服务器性能:服务器处理能力不足,无法及时处理大量数据,导致数据传输延迟或丢失。
- 编码与压缩:直播过程中,数据需要进行编码和压缩,若编码与压缩方式不当,会增加数据传输的负担,影响直播效果。
三、解决数据传输问题的方法
- 优化网络环境:针对网络不稳定的问题,可以通过优化网络设置、提高网络带宽等方式,提高直播的稳定性。
- 升级服务器:提高服务器处理能力,确保直播过程中数据传输的流畅性。
- 改进编码与压缩:采用高效、稳定的编码与压缩方式,降低数据传输的负担。
案例分析
以某知名直播平台为例,该平台曾因服务器处理能力不足,导致大量用户在直播过程中出现画面和声音延迟的现象。针对这一问题,平台及时升级了服务器,优化了编码与压缩方式,有效解决了数据传输问题,提高了用户观看体验。
总之,手机app直播制作中的数据传输问题是影响直播效果的关键因素。通过优化网络环境、升级服务器、改进编码与压缩等措施,可以有效解决数据传输问题,为用户提供更优质的直播体验。
猜你喜欢:海外直播卡顿原因